Output e56381b75365ac9e38fa7e17f93bc3ca0c59760118ef729161aa845342cfc164:2

value
19773881
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40b22638eca93533f8eb0d954e18feb3f78c9596 OP_EQUAL
address
MDoEtjmJWnAgSNi6VzFJRcL385TVzV2Vfz
transaction
e56381b75365ac9e38fa7e17f93bc3ca0c59760118ef729161aa845342cfc164
spent
true